By Janet Plume





NEW ORLEANS–Two key players in eight-year-old Lord Breen Fernandez here have left the agency in what founder John Lord called a ‘restructuring move.’





Gone from the agency are partner and principal Bobby Breen and creative director Norm Glenmeyer.





Earlier this month, Lord divested Breen of his interest in the agency, which will now be called Lord Fernandez.





Breen was a former Jefferson Parish sheriff’s deputy who helped Lord found the shop with Wayne Fernandez.





Lord said Breen’s departure was based on ‘philosophical differences in the direction the agency is going.’
